Transaction e30950638b5bdf99e7ef7e4a7b1c8e9db0e0a6fc589fba6e0783d712aac03a7b
1 Input
1 Output
-
e30950638b5bdf99e7ef7e4a7b1c8e9db0e0a6fc589fba6e0783d712aac03a7b:0
- value
- 1001245
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ce15a713bfbd658718907b70aae0cab9a2a59c82
- address
- bc1qec26wyalh4jcwxys0dc24cx2hx32t8yz9zku66